Analysis

The most recent figure for perc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Kazakhstan is 16.1%, measured in 2020.

That represents a change of down 1.8% on the previous year and down 5.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Kazakhstan peaked at 18.0% in 2015 and was at its lowest, 1.6%, in 1999.

Kazakhstan ranks 89th of 171 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 14 years of available data.

Perc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Kazakhstan, year by year

Annual values for Perc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private institutions, both sexes (%) in Kazakhstan, 1999 to 2020.
Year % Change
1999 1.6%
2000 3.2% +103.5%
2006 13.7% +328.6%
2010 17.0% +24.7%
2011 15.4% -9.5%
2012 15.2% -1.8%
2013 15.5% +2.3%
2014 17.7% +14.3%
2015 18.0% +1.6%
2016 17.8% -1.5%
2017 15.6% -12.1%
2018 15.7% +0.4%
2019 16.3% +4.3%
2020 16.1% -1.8%
